What Is Alocasia Frydek Variegated Bulb

Alocasia Frydek Variegated Bulbs

The Alocasia Frydek Variegated bulb, also known as the ‘mother bulb’, is the starting point of the Alocasia Frydek Variegated plant’s life cycle. This bulb is a storage organ which contains all the necessary nutrients and genetic material to give birth to a new plant. The bulb is typically large, round, and brown, with a firm texture.

When planted and given appropriate care, it grows into the Green Velvet with its resplendent dark green leaves and striking white veining. This bulb is a treasure trove of potential, ready to unfurl into a magnificent houseplant under the right conditions.

The Planting Process: Bringing the Alocasia Frydek Variegated Bulb to Life

The Alocasia Frydek Variegated, with its striking green leaves veined in white, is a show-stopping addition to any plant collection. Typically, these plants are grown from bulbs, which can be planted either in early spring or year-round if you’re growing them indoors. This guide will walk you through the process of planting and nurturing an Alocasia Frydek Variegated bulb.

Timing and Environment for Planting:

Alocasia Frydek Variegated bulbs are traditionally planted in early spring, as the warming weather provides ideal conditions for growth. However, indoor planting allows you to control environmental factors such as temperature and humidity, making it possible to plant the bulb at any time of the year.

Selecting the Perfect Pot:

Importance of Drainage:
Begin by choosing a pot with adequate drainage to prevent water accumulation, which could lead to the bulb rotting. The pot should have one or more drainage holes at the bottom to allow excess water to escape easily.

Size Matters:

The size of the pot also plays a crucial role. It should be large enough to accommodate the bulb and allow space for root development. As a rule of thumb, choose a pot that is at least twice as wide as the bulb.

Preparing the Ideal Soil Mix:

The Alocasia Frydek Variegated prefers slightly acidic to neutral pH levels. A peat-based soil mix is often a good choice as it retains moisture while ensuring proper drainage. For added drainage, consider mixing in some perlite or coarse sand.

Properly Planting the Bulb:

Identify the growth points on the bulb, which should be facing upwards when planted. These are typically slightly pointed and may already have a bud or shoot. After positioning the bulb, cover it with about 2 inches of soil. Make sure the soil is firm, but not overly compacted around the bulb.

Watering and Ongoing Care:

After planting, water the bulb thoroughly. However, ensure that the water drains out completely to avoid waterlogging the soil, which could lead to rotting. During the growing season, aim to keep the soil consistently moist but not waterlogged.

Creating Optimal Growing Conditions:

Alocasia Frydek Variegated plants thrive in warm, humid conditions. Strive to maintain a temperature between 65-75 degrees Fahrenheit and high humidity levels. If you’re growing the plant indoors, consider using a humidifier or placing the pot on a tray filled with water and pebbles to increase humidity levels.

Waiting for Growth:

Patience is key when growing Alocasia Frydek Variegated from bulbs. It may take a few weeks for the first shoots to emerge. However, once they do, the plant will grow rapidly, and you’ll soon be rewarded with the striking foliage this plant variety is known for.

Care Tips: Nurturing Your Alocasia Frydek Variegated

Alocasia Frydek Variegated

Once your Alocasia Frydek Variegated bulb sprouts, the journey is far from over. In fact, it’s just beginning! As tropical plants, these specimens have specific care requirements to thrive. Here are some essential care tips to ensure your Alocasia Frydek Variegated grows lush and healthy.

Understanding Light Requirements:

  • The Power of Indirect Light:
    Alocasia Frydek Variegated plants love bright, indirect light. Direct sunlight can scorch their leaves, causing them to turn yellow or brown. Place your plant near a north or east-facing window where it will receive plenty of light but not direct sun.
  • Monitoring Light Levels:
    Regularly monitor your plant’s light exposure. Signs of insufficient light can include slow growth or smaller-than-usual leaves. Conversely, if the leaves become discolored or scorched, they may be getting too much direct sunlight.

Watering Your Alocasia Frydek Variegated:

  • Consistent Watering:
    These plants enjoy consistent watering, which mimics their natural tropical environment. However, they don’t like to sit in water, so it’s essential to allow the soil to partially dry out between waterings to prevent root rot.
  • Avoiding Overwatering:
    Be wary of overwatering your Alocasia Frydek Variegated as this can lead to root rot, a common issue with these plants. If the leaves start to yellow or droop, this could be a sign of overwatering.

Maintaining Humidity Levels:

Alocasia Frydek Variegated plants are native to humid environments, so they thrive in high humidity. There are several ways to maintain the right humidity levels for your plant.

  • Using a Pebble Tray:
    One method is to use a pebble tray. Fill a shallow tray with pebbles and add water until it reaches just below the top of the pebbles. Place your pot on this tray, ensuring the bottom of the pot is not in direct contact with the water. As the water evaporates, it creates a humid microclimate around the plant.
  • Utilizing a Room Humidifier:
    Alternatively, you can use a room humidifier to increase humidity levels, especially during drier months or if you’re growing the plant in an air-conditioned room.

Regular Feeding:

Alocasia Frydek Variegated plants are heavy feeders and benefit from regular feeding during the growing season. Use a balanced liquid houseplant fertilizer, diluted to half the recommended strength, every two weeks from spring through summer.

Troubleshooting Common Issues with the Alocasia Frydek Variegated Bulb

Alocasia Frydek Variegated Bulbs

Growing the Alocasia Frydek Variegated Bulb can indeed be rewarding, but like any plant, it can sometimes face challenges. Understanding these issues and how to rectify them can ensure your plant stays healthy and thriving.

Over or Under-Watering:

  • Identifying the Issue:
    Over or under-watering is a common problem with Alocasia Frydek Variegated plants. Signs of overwatering include yellowing leaves and wilting, while under-watering often results in drooping leaves.
  • Finding the Balance:
    Striking the right balance is crucial. The soil should be consistently moist but not waterlogged. If you notice signs of over or under-watering, adjust your watering schedule accordingly.

Temperature Stress:

Recognizing Symptoms:

Alocasia Frydek Variegated plants are tropical and prefer warm temperatures. If exposed to cold drafts or fluctuating temperatures, they may exhibit signs of stress, such as yellowing or curling leaves.

Maintaining Optimal Temperatures:

Keep your plant in a location where the temperature is consistently between 65-75Β°F (18-24Β°C). Avoid placing it near air conditioning vents or drafty windows.

Inadequate Light:

Spotting the Problem:

If your Alocasia Frydek Variegated is not receiving enough light, it may exhibit slow growth or smaller than usual leaves. Conversely, too much direct sunlight can scorch the leaves.

Adjusting Light Conditions:

Locate your plant in a spot where it receives bright, indirect light. Monitor it regularly and adjust its position if necessary to ensure it’s getting the right amount of light.

Pest Infestation:

Identifying Pests:

Pest infestations can also be a problem for the Alocasia Frydek Variegated. Common pests include spider mites, mealybugs, and aphids, which can cause discolored or spotted leaves.

Managing Pests:

Check your plant regularly for signs of pests. If you spot any, remove them manually or use an insecticidal soap or neem oil solution to treat the infestation.

Alocasia Frydek Variegated Bulb Price:

The price of an Alocasia Frydek Variegated bulb can vary significantly depending on its size and health. On average, you can expect to pay anywhere between $20 and $100 for a high-quality bulb from a reputable supplier.

It’s important to remember that while price can be an indicator of quality, it’s crucial to ensure you’re purchasing from a trusted vendor who provides healthy, pest-free bulbs. It’s also worth noting that the rare variegated variety may command higher prices due to its unique and striking appearance.
